Integration of CFD simulation and Experiment to Investigate the Soil Removal Characteristic of the Tire
Resumo
The soil removal characteristic of a tire is important especially for some specific conditions or applications. The main content of this paper is to propose a methodology to investigate the soil removal characteristic of a tire between the CFD simulation and real vehicle test. The CFD simulation using Herschel-Bulkley Model for Non-Newton Fluid for modeling the mud behavior would obtain the lift force of the tire caused by the contact between the tire bottom and the soil ground. A case study for the tires of self-propelled mowers are presented. The investigation of the lift force via the CFD simulation and the traction from the real vehicle test with different tire pattern is discussed.
